How We Work
1
Immediate Contact
Your call connects you directly with a certified technician. We gather initial details about the water damage and dispatch a rapid response team to your Asheville property. Quick action prevents further damage.
2
Damage Assessment
Upon arrival, our team uses specialized moisture meters and thermal imaging to accurately assess the extent of water intrusion. This detailed inspection informs our custom drying plan and identifies all affected areas.
3
Water Extraction
Powerful industrial-grade extractors remove standing water quickly. We then strategically place high-volume air movers and dehumidifiers to begin the thorough drying process, preventing mold growth.
4
Drying & Monitoring
We continuously monitor temperature, humidity, and moisture levels. Our team makes necessary adjustments to equipment, ensuring optimal drying conditions until structural materials are completely dry and safe.
5
Restoration & Repair
Once fully dry, we proceed with any necessary repairs or reconstruction. Our goal is to return your property to its pre-damage condition, completing the restoration with a final quality check.

Warning Signs You Need Frozen Pipe Water Removal in Wade Hampton, SC

It's essential to catch these signs early to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

If you notice a musty smell in your home that won't go away it could be a sign of a frozen pipe.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and fix it quickly.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Don't ignore water stains on your ceiling or walls. They could be a sign of a frozen pipe that's leaking water onto your property.

Increased Water Bills

If your water bills are suddenly higher than usual it could be a sign of a frozen pipe that's causing water to leak onto your property.

Q: Can I prevent frozen pipes from happening in the first place?

A: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ent frozen pipes from happening in the first place, including insulating exposed pipes, keeping your home warm, and letting cold water drip from the faucet served by exposed pipes.
